If you are applying from a country outside of the U.S. please follow these steps:
- Complete the International Undergraduate Admission Application online or download a PDF.
- Submit the completed application and $50 non-refundable application fee (in U.S. funds) by check or money order. We do not accept cash.
- Have all official transcripts translated into English
- Make sure we also receive the original official transcripts in your native language
- Submit descriptions of the courses on your transcript so we can give you appropriate transfer credit
- Submit your signed statement of financial support and supporting bank statement
- Submit TOEFL and TWE or MELAB and oral scores
- Provide a signed photograph of yourself (only one is needed)
- Include a photocopy of your current visa documents if you hold a non-immigrant status
Additional tips to help the process:
- English translations of documents must bear the seal/stamp of the issuing institution
- Your statement of financial support cannot be older than six months
- Bank supporting documentation must show the dollar amount equivalent to the financial requirements for undergraduate international students
- English proficiency tests cannot be more than two years old
- Checks drawn on foreign banks should carry the notation “Payable in U.S. funds, plus service charges”
All application materials must be recieved by the following dates:
August 1 - fall semester (Sept. - Dec.)
December 1 - winter semester (Jan. - April)
April 1 - spring/summer semesters (May - Aug.)
